I will be sure to take lot of pics. Im not going to be running a mishimoto radiator though. I found a custom radiator on ebay that is the exact measurements I need. the mishi is to big. The best part of doing this setup is increased surface area for better cooling vs a half core. Then to go even further it will increase coolant capacity and also with the cross flow dual pass design will increase cooling capabilities as well.

The radiator will be taking place of my a/c condenser inside the radiator support. i will eventually get a civic condenser and put it where the current radiator sits so i can have a/c in the car but thats the least of my concerns right now.
